Transaction e8417282859ff1d1f6eca7aed868459799423e47d55b0b69b5368fec4a8edc63

2 Input
2 Outputs
  • e8417282859ff1d1f6eca7aed868459799423e47d55b0b69b5368fec4a8edc63:0
  • value  110995
    address  12A53wYRN6SguK8uPM5tzeGzZS9y6z8WgG
  • e8417282859ff1d1f6eca7aed868459799423e47d55b0b69b5368fec4a8edc63:1
  • value  10624309
    address  15pf4FYG8sv9fRwfgWc4BhMg1RNyLbXrxb